Edge protection

A simple rule is that if your employees work at a height of more than a meter with an exposed edge, you need some form of fall protection. This is typically the case with mezzanine floors and around lifts or stairs. Our all in one solution combines conventional hand and knee rail with mesh panels for improved protection against falling items.

How warehouse partitioning is used in practice

Warehouse partitioning is used to bring structure and order to everyday warehouse operations. Our mesh systems make it possible to define clear storage zones in open environments, separate work areas without blocking visibility, and create secure cages for valuable or sensitive goods.

Partitioning supports temporary or changing flows, helping warehouses stay organised as volumes, layouts or processes shift. Combined with anti-collapse systems, mesh shelving and impact protection, partitioning helps protect goods, people, racking and infrastructure while supporting efficient, well-structured warehouse operations.

Secure goods and assets

Security cages are used to protect valuable and sensitive goods by creating enclosed storage areas within open or shared environments. Mesh-based warehouse storage cages provide clear structure and controlled access while maintaining visibility and order that supports inventory management.

By separating and organizing stored goods, partitioning helps reduce losses, prevent unauthorized access without compromising flexibility or day-to-day operations.
